Use the given information to find the P-value. Also, use a 0.05 significance level and state the conclusion about the null hypot

hesis (reject the null hypothesis or fail to reject the null hypothesis).
The test statistic in a two-tailed test is z = -1.63.

a. 0.1031; fail to reject the null hypothesis
b. 0.0516; reject the null hypothesis
c. 0.9484; fail to reject the null hypothesis
d. 0.0516; fail to reject the null hypothesis

Answer: a. 0.1031; fail to reject the null hypothesis

Step-by-step explanation:

Given: Significance level : \alpha=0.05

The test statistic in a two-tailed test is z = -1.63.

The P-value for two-tailed test : 2P(Z>|z|)=2P(Z>|-1.63|)=0.1031 [By p-value table]

Since, 0.1031 > 0.05

i.e. p-value > \alpha

So, we fail to reject the null hypothesis. [When p<\alpha then we reject null hypothesis  ]

So, the correct option is a. 0.1031; fail to reject the null hypothesis.
